Description Suggest change

Bring your heaviest trousers and be ready to get swallowed whole by this delightful, albeit short offwidth. The crack starts with a tipped out #5 and some bomber hand-fist stacks. Haul yourself into a flared pod on fist-fist stacks halfway up the climb where you can get a chicken wing and a #6 overhead. The clock is ticking; take a couple gasps of air, cry, embrace the full body enervation.. grovel your way back into hand-fist stacks that bring you to the top. Interior Alaska's own "Monster Offwidth".

Location Suggest change

A small pinnacle can be seen 200ft downriver from the Pandemic camp spot. The OW crack is on the downhill (South) side of this small protrusion. 

Protection Suggest change

(2) #5, (1) #6.
Sling anchor 25ft above the topout.
